Allentown is a charming city in Pennsylvania known for its rich industrial history and vibrant cultural scene. Travelers can enjoy the Allentown Art Museum, picturesque parks, and unique events like Mayfair. Dorney Park & Wildwater Kingdom offers thrilling amusement rides, while a stroll along the Lehigh River is perfect for nature lovers. Foodies can indulge in local delicacies, including Pennsylvania Dutch treats. With lively arts districts and historical tours, Allentown presents a diverse urban experience. A visit during the mild spring or colorful autumn seasons is ideal, offering pleasant weather and unique events for tourists.

Local Laws
Travelers should be aware of local laws regarding alcohol consumption, which is restricted in public areas, and smoking bans in certain public spaces.
Crime Rates
Allentown has a moderate crime rate with incidents of property crime being more common than violent crime. The city has been working on community policing to improve safety.
Health Risks
Healthcare facilities are available and accessible in Allentown. There are no significant health risks specific to the area.
Natural Disasters
Allentown is not prone to frequent natural disasters, but it can experience severe weather conditions such as heavy snow in winter and occasional thunderstorms.
Law Enforcement
Law enforcement presence is visible in Allentown, with regular patrols and community engagement initiatives aimed at reducing crime.
Public Transportation
Public transportation in Allentown is generally safe, but travelers should remain vigilant, especially during late hours.
Solo Travelers
Solo travelers should exercise standard precautions, especially when exploring downtown areas at night.
Recent Developments
There have been efforts to revitalize downtown Allentown, which include increased security measures and community programs to enhance safety.

Summary: The best time to visit Allentown is during the spring (April to June) and fall (September to November) when temperatures range from 10-25°C (50-77°F). These seasons offer comfortable weather and vibrant festivals, perfect for exploring the city’s culture and attractions.
January
Cold and snowy with temperatures from -6 to 4°C (20-39°F). Ideal for indoor activities and exploring historical sites.
February
Similar to January, with slightly warmer days, perfect for museum visits and cozy cafes.
March
Transition month with temperatures from 1 to 11°C (34-52°F). Early spring signs and smaller crowds.
April
Mild temperatures from 6 to 17°C (43-63°F) with blossoming parks and gardens.
May
Warm weather and vibrant festivals with temperatures from 11 to 22°C (52-72°F), ideal for outdoor explorations.
June
Start of summer, temperatures from 16 to 27°C (61-81°F), perfect for water parks and outdoor events.
July
Hot summer days (19 to 30°C / 66-86°F), great for amusement parks and outdoor concerts.
August
Similar to July, with summer festivals and activities in full swing.
September
Cooling down with temperatures from 14 to 25°C (57-77°F), perfect for crisp fall air and harvest festivals.
October
Charming autumn colors and moderate temperatures (8 to 18°C / 46-64°F), ideal for scenic walks.
November
Cooler weather with temperatures from 3 to 11°C (37-53°F), quieter and peaceful.
December
Holiday festivities and winter activities, temperatures ranging from -3 to 6°C (27-43°F).

Lehigh Valley International Airport (ABE)
Lehigh Valley International Airport is small, offering quick check-ins and essential facilities, with easy parking and rental car options.
Approximately 20 minutes and 7 miles via Airport Road.
Enjoy shorter lines and a relaxed experience. Suitable for regional trips.

Philadelphia International Airport (PHL)
Philadelphia International Airport offers diverse dining, shopping, and lounges, with accessibility options including shuttles and elevators.
Approximately 1.5 hours and 70 miles via I-476 S.
Consider using SEPTA for public transport. TSA checkpoints can be busy. Plan accordingly.
